Job Description: We are seeking a Senior Application Architect who operates as a product-focused technical leader and advisor within a large federal health program. This role partners closely with the Program Manager, Product Managers, and stakeholders to shape product strategy, define technical direction, and ensure delivery aligns with mission outcomes, user needs, and long-term platform sustainability. The ideal candidate balances hands-on architectural expertise with product and program-level thinking, serving as a trusted technical advisor who translates business objectives into scalable, secure, and maintainable solutions. This individual will be responsible for roadmaps, evaluates tradeoffs of implementations, mitigates technical risk, and guides teams toward solutions that maximize value across multiple products and delivery teams. Basic Requirements:
- Ability to successfully obtain a U.S. Federal Position of Trust clearance designation.
- Must reside in and be able to perform work in the United States.
- Must have lived in the United States for 3 of the last 5 years.
- Bachelor's Degree and at least 4 years leading/architecting all phases of the agile software development life cycle.
- Over eight (8) years of progressive experience as developer, senior developer, lead developer etc. building and architecting large scale enterprise applications using Javascript, Node.JS and Angular to build SPA and REST based architectures.
- Two (2) or more years of experience working with Federal Healthcare IT Projects. Other government contract project management experience will be considered.
- Expertise with Microsoft Office applications (Word, Excel, Power Point, SharePoint, etc.).
- Experience in an Agile environment, leading agile sprint teams and using agile collaboration tools (Jira, confluence, etc.)
- Demonstrate experience applying Human-Centered Design (HCD) principles to product strategy, solution design, and technical decision-making
- Ensure solutions are designed with a clear understanding of user workflows, pain points, and accessibility needs
- Demonstrated ability to diagnose business problems, and support to come up with product roadmaps and timelines for product implementation.
- Demonstrate the ability to lead and support digital transformation of a product, modernizing legacy capabilities into scalable, user-centered digital solutions aligned with mission outcomes
- Demonstrated ability to analyze complex data and business for business operations; demonstrated ability to understand user needs for system and interfaces and come up with requirement documentation. Able to perform end-to-end business process analysis to identify gaps and come up with improvements.
- Verifiable experience with architecting applications, systems or products using agile & iterative practices
- Must be able to exercise critical and rational thinking to identify alternate solutions, strengths & weakness of each option, documenting and discussing them with stakeholders to inform decisions.
- Must have demonstrated experience in documenting complex technical and business problems in a simple & intuitive manner that others can understand.
- Must have experience in architecting and hands-on implementation experience with modern technologies stack like Node.js, Angular latest versions, Fastify, Lambda, AWS, PostgreSQL
- Excellent oral and written communication skills and must be detailed oriented.
- Must be able to effectively and professionally communicate with management, peers and customers as well as demonstrate sound judgment/reasoning skills
- Must show appetite for active learning, embracing change and mentoring others in organization.
- Knowledge of Healthcare, Medicare and Medicaid systems and data is a plus.
- Demonstrated ability to come up with system designs, architecture, process flows and Concept of Operations for large complex systems
- Demonstrated experience with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e)
- Strong understanding of AWS Well-Architected Framework principles and hands-on experience with infrastructure-as-code tools like Terraform for deploying and managing scalable, secure, and efficient cloud solutions.
- Proficiency in designing systems using UML and BPM techniques to effectively communicate and document complex processes and system architectures.
- Demonstrate experience using Amazon SQS to support asynchronous, reliable message-based communication between system components.
- Hands-on expertise in building, fine-tuning, and deploying large language models (LLMs) using platforms like Amazon Bedrock or similar generative AI services.
- Experience with developing, customizing, and managing Drupal-based websites, including a solid understanding of module development, theming, and site configuration.
- Experience with Big data technologies such as Hadoop, Spark, Machine Learning and one more cloud environments (AWS, Google and Azure) . AWS preferred.
- Will be responsible for overseeing 4 teams of developers, and 6 applications made from a mix of front end, back end, and ETL technologies.
